Páginas filhas
  • RPTMIG00019.1.1 - Executando Fórmulas onde Resultado deve ser Mostrado de Imediato

Versões comparadas

Chave

  • Esta linha foi adicionada.
  • Esta linha foi removida.
  • A formatação mudou.

...

Produto:

TOTVS Reports

Versões:

12.1.x

Ocorrência:

 

Ambiente:

 

Passo a passo:

Conteúdo


Índice
excludeConteúdo|

Consulta SQL Vinculada a Bandas do Relatorio|Galeria Consulta SQL Vinculada a Banda|Galeria Consulta SQL Não Vinculada a Banda

Executando Fórmulas onde Resultado deve ser Mostrado de Imediato

Introdução


 

Com o advento da migração do TOTVS Reports da versão 11.8x para as versões superiores a versão 12.1.4, muitas alterações foram feitas principalmente na geração sobre demanda dos dados vinculados a cada componente presente no relatório.

Em relatórios da versão 11.8x, por exemplo, a geração sobre demanda dos dados era realizada no momento da impressão de cada componente, ao contrário dos das versões mais atuais (12.1.5 ou superiores), onde a geração dos dados é feita através de apenas uma consulta SQL (Fase de Preparação), que é gerada a partir das tabelas e consultas SQL vinculadas ao relatório.

1 - Executando Fórmulas onde Resultado deve ser Mostrado de Imediato


 

Existem diversos tipos de fórmulas, com diversos propósitos, vamos tratar, porém, de fórmulas, que necessitam do resultado imediato, para que o relatório apresente valores devidamente atualizados.

 

1.1 - Executando Fórmulas com Resultado Imediato (1180)


Vamos utilizar o relatório abaixo como exemplo:

OBS: A fórmula FRM003 atualiza a tabela "Histórico de Disciplinas Concluídas".

Temos os campos necessários para a execução da Fórmula e para a execução da Consulta SQL vinculada a banda "Detalhe2".

Como na versão 1180 gera as informações sobre demanda, ou seja, prepara e executa os controles em um mesmo momento, a fórmula será executada, a tabela Histórico de Disciplinas Concluídas será atualizada, e consequentemente o relatório será gerado com as informações já atualizadas.

Observações: